The error message "Already taken." is associated with the allocation of names in COYO. To be more precise, it concerns the name of a page, community or app. If you receive this error message, an entry for this name already exists.
What lies behind this?
If you create, for instance, a page, the associated path via URL is also created at the same time. The entry point for the URL is always the same – this is the domain of your digital home. The ending after it varies depending on the selected element. We refer to this ending as a "slug".
The "slug" is comprehensive and identifies the specific page, community or app. In the case of homepages, pages, and communities, this can only be used once. There can therefore only be one named entry.
Example:
- Domain: https://coyocloud.digitaleheimat.com
- Slug: /pages/coyo-news/apps/timeline (timeline on the COYO News page)
https://coyocloud.digitaleheimat.com/pages/coyo-news/apps/timeline
